Palatoglossus
Summary
The
palatoglossus muscle
is one of the
muscles of the soft palate
that plays a crucial role in
elevating the posterior part of the tongue
and
closing the oropharyngeal isthmus
during swallowing. It is innervated by the pharyngeal plexus of the
vagus nerve
, making it unique among
tongue muscles
, which are typically innervated by the
hypoglossal nerve
.
